About Bagwa Village
Bagwa is a large village in Garhani tehsil, in the district of Bhojpur, Bihar.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 4,084, made up of 2,160 males and 1,924 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 891 females per 1000 males. The village covers 398 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 802203,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Bagwa
The census records public bus service for Bagwa as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within village.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
